The ALCPT score ranges from 0 to 100 and corresponds to specific proficiency levels. A score of 60 or higher is the standard minimum for US government-sponsored training programs. For example, a score between 85 and 100 indicates an advanced level with native-like comprehension, while a score between 70 and 84 represents an upper-intermediate level that qualifies for most US programs. A score between 60 and 69 is the intermediate level that serves as the minimum qualifying score.
